Industrial Cutting Landscape in Iraq

Analyzing the challenges of metal seal and component manufacturing in the Middle East.

The manufacturing sector in Iraq, particularly in the production of metal seals and general components, operates under extreme climatic conditions. High ambient temperatures and abrasive dust particles significantly accelerate the wear and tear of slitting machine blades, necessitating materials with superior thermal stability and hardness.

Currently, many local facilities rely on legacy equipment that requires frequent maintenance. The demand for high-precision straight cutting blade technology is increasing as Iraq seeks to diversify its economy and upgrade its infrastructure, moving away from basic imports toward localized high-quality production.

Furthermore, the food processing and packaging sectors in urban centers like Baghdad and Basra are integrating more automated systems, creating a surged demand for specialized tooling such as tomato slicer blades that can maintain edge retention despite high-volume throughput.

Evolution of Cutting Technology in Iraq

From traditional manual shears to automated precision slitting systems.

Market Development History

In the early 2000s, the Iraqi general equipment industry relied heavily on carbon steel tools and manual operations, where shear slitting knives were primarily maintained via basic grinding techniques, often resulting in inconsistent tolerances.

Between 2010 and 2020, a transition occurred toward tungsten carbide and high-speed steel (HSS) alloys. This era saw the introduction of imported CNC slitting machinery, which demanded higher precision in blade geometry to reduce material waste and increase production speed.

From 2021 to the present, the focus has shifted toward "Smart Cutting." Modern facilities are now adopting coated blades (TiN, DLC) to combat the oxidative stress caused by Iraq's arid climate, ensuring longer lifecycles for industrial tooling.

How to prevent overheating in slitting machine blades in hot climates?

We recommend using blades with specialized DLC coatings and ensuring a consistent cooling lubrication system to mitigate the effect of Iraq's high ambient temperatures.

What is the expected lifespan of rotary slitter knives when cutting hardened steel?

Lifespan varies by material, but our tungsten carbide rotary knives are engineered for 3-5x longer life compared to standard HSS blades in high-stress Iraqi industrial apps.
